66kV relay protection device

66kV protection relays are devices that detect faults in high-voltage systems and initiate circuit breaker operation to isolate faulty sections, ensuring system safety and reliability.Working PrincipleA protective relay continuously monitors electrical quantities such as current, voltage, frequency, and impedance. In a 66kV system, current transformers (CTs) and voltage transformers (VTs) provide scaled-down signals to the relay. When a fault occurs, such as a short circuit or overload, the relay detects abnormal values and sends a trip signal to the circuit breaker, isolating the faulty section from the healthy network. The relay itself does not interrupt current; it acts as a decision-making device, while the breaker performs the physical disconnection .Types of 66kV Protection RelaysProtection relays can be classified based on operating principle, function, or mechanism:Based on Operating PrincipleElectromechanical Relays: Use moving parts and electromagnetic forces; traditional and robust for high-voltage applications .Static Relays: Use electronic components without moving parts, offering faster response .Numerical/Digital Relays: Microprocessor-based relays providing advanced protection, monitoring, and communication features .Based on FunctionOvercurrent Relay (OCR): Trips when current exceeds a preset limit; can be instantaneous or time-delayed .Differential Relay: Compares currents at two points (e.g., transformer windings) and trips if the difference exceeds a threshold .Distance Relay: Operates based on line impedance; commonly used for transmission line protection .Earth Fault Relay: Detects leakage currents to ground .Over/Under Voltage Relay: Protects against abnormal voltage conditions .Frequency Relay: Trips when system frequency deviates from normal limits .Based on MechanismElectromagnetic Relays: Operate via solenoid or moving coil mechanisms .Mechanical Relays: Use gears and mechanical displacement to actuate contacts .Static Relays: Semiconductor-based switching without moving parts .Digital Relays: Logic-based operation using microprocessors, programmable via PC or USB .Applications in 66kV SystemsTransmission Lines: Distance and overcurrent relays protect lines from short circuits and overloads.Transformers: Differential and overcurrent relays prevent winding faults and overheating.Busbars: Full scheme busbar protection panels use multiple relays to isolate faults quickly .Switchgear: Relays integrated with 66kV switchgear ensure safe operation and coordination with upstream and downstream devices.Key FeaturesHigh accuracy and fast response to minimize equipment damage.Coordination with other relays and breakers to isolate only the faulted section.Alarm and indication functions for monitoring, such as SF6 low alarm or winding temperature alarms .Relay inputs are typically powered by 110V DC battery supply and comply with standards like BSEN 60255 and IEC 60255 . In summary, 66kV protection relays are critical for safeguarding high-voltage equipment, ensuring system stability, and minimizing outage impact. Their selection depends on the type of equipment, fault characteristics, and system coordination requirements.
